6 FAQs about [Belarus Gomel Energy Storage Power Station Consumption]
What is the total energy consumption of Belarus?
Belarus' total energy consumption, measured by total primary energy supply, was 27.0 Mtoe in 2018. This is comparable with consumption in Norway and Hungary. The industry sector is the largest final energy consumer, with a 36% share (7.3 Mtoe in 2018); it is also the greatest consumer of electricity and heat.
Who operates the electricity sector in Belarus?
The electricity sector is operated by a single vertically integrated national energy company, BelEnergo. While gas distribution is handled by BelTopGaz, the government believes that having control over the entire energy sector will guarantee a secure and stable energy supply.
Does Belarus have a power system?
Belarus is involved in implementing numerous interstate and international treaties in energy, including participation in the Commonwealth of Independent States (CIS) agreement on the co-ordination of interstate relations in the power sector.
Why does Belarus need control over the energy sector?
Belarus seeks control over the entire energy sector to guarantee a secure and stable energy supply. Due to its limited natural resources, the country relies heavily on energy imports from Russia.
Is Belarus energy self-sufficient?
In 2018, only 15% of Belarus's energy demand was met by domestic production, making it one of the least energy self-sufficient countries in the world.
Does Belarus have a geothermal potential?
Belarus’s geothermal potential is relatively undiscovered, with only a few regions having been tested. Of the tested regions, the most promising geothermal energy potential lies in the Pripyat Trough (Gomel region) and the Podlasie-Brest Depression (Brest region), in dozens of abandoned deep wells.
